Driving Malaysia’s Global Business Events Vision The partnership aligns with MyCEB’s 2026 strategic plan, “BE Malaysia Go Global: Unlocking New Markets”, which focuses on expanding Malaysia’s international visibility and attracting high-value Business Events. The initiative targets both established and emerging markets, including the Middle East (MENA), Central Asia, Eastern Europe, and rapidly growing destinations across Southeast Asia.
As of 21 November 2025, MyCEB has successfully generated an Estimated Economic Impact (EEI) of RM4.08 billion generated by international participants for the nation. This achievement underscores the commitment of MyCEB, the confidence of global partners, and the collective strength of Malaysia’s Business Events ecosystem.
